Market Trends in the Enterprise Cloud Services Market

- Multi-cloud strategy adoption: Enterprises are increasingly leveraging multiple cloud providers to achieve cost efficiency, scalability, and flexibility.

-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) integration: AI and ML technologies are being integrated into cloud services to enhance automation, improve data analytics, and optimize business operations.

- Edge computing integration: Edge computing is becoming more prevalent in enterprise cloud services to reduce latency, improve performance, and enhance data security for IoT devices and applications.

- Hybrid cloud deployments: Enterprises are opting for hybrid cloud solutions to leverage the benefits of both public and private clouds, resulting in improved data security, compliance, and cost optimization.

- Security and compliance enhancements: With growing concerns about data privacy and cyber threats, enterprises are prioritizing security and compliance features in cloud services to protect sensitive information and meet regulatory requirements.

In terms of Product Type, the Enterprise Cloud Services market is segmented into:

  • Business
  • Network

Enterprise cloud services can be categorized into two main types: business cloud services and network cloud services. Business cloud services include applications and platforms that help businesses manage their operations, such as customer relationship management (CRM) tools and enterprise resource planning (ERP) software. On the other hand, network cloud services focus on providing infrastructure components like servers, storage, and networking capabilities. Among these two types, business cloud services dominate the market share significantly due to the growing need for companies to streamline their operations, improve efficiency, and enhance customer experiences through cloud-based solutions.

In terms of Product Application, the Enterprise Cloud Services market is segmented into:

  • SMEs
  • Large Enterprises

Enterprise Cloud Services offer scalability, flexibility, and cost-efficiency for both SMEs and Large Enterprises. SMEs can leverage cloud services for data storage, collaboration tools, and software applications without the need for large investment in IT infrastructure. Large Enterprises can utilize cloud services for complex data analytics, customer relationship management, and global scalable infrastructure.

The fastest growing application segment in terms of revenue is the Software as a Service (SaaS) model, allowing businesses to access software applications over the internet on a subscription basis, eliminating the need for complex software installations and maintenance. SaaS applications include customer relationship management, human resources management, and accounting software.
